Better Teachers, Better Preschools: Student Achievement Linked to Teacher QualificationsNIEER Policy Brief (Issue 2, March 2003) Research has linked early learning and development to the educational qualifications of teachers. The most effective preschool teachers -- those with at least a four-year college degree and specialized training in early childhood -- have more responsive interactions with children, provide richer language and cognitive experiences, and are less authoritarian. High-quality preschool education depends on effective, high-quality teachers.
